Commissioning an Original Oil Painting

The first step in this process is imagining in your mind what you want in terms
of subject matter, overall feeling, price and where you will hang the painting.
I will assist you on a personal basis either in person or via telephone whichever
is more practical.
Once you have decided on a subject it is important that I get an idea of what
you envision whether it is a mental idea or a physical place. There are circumstances
when an in-person observation is not possible but the best method is for me to
visit the place and sketch and photograph the area. I can work directly from photographs
however photos are usually inaccurate in terms of color and perspective. This
research phase is the most important as this is the foundation from which I will
create your painting.
This is the time for a free flow of thoughts as to what direction you want me
to go with your painting. Discussion is essential and if you have a particular
feeling that you want the end product to convey please let me know-perhaps there
is a certain time of day, an era of the past, or a painting of mine that you would
like for me to keep in mind. Remember this is your painting and I want you to
love it!
Now that I know what you want in the painting I can give you my recommendations
for a final concept and price. This is the point where we agree on the details
of the project and I continue... I will then allign the creation of your painting
with my schedule and give you start and finish dates. These can vary due to current
projects and the amount of work involved in your painting. Exact dates can be
set but remember that this is an original work of art.
During the final phase of painting I will seek your approval to continue and ask
if any changes need to be made. This will be carried out either in person, photographically,
or high resolution e-mail.
Upon approval, the final payment is due and arrangements will be started to deliver
the painting to you.
Framing of the painting is not included in the price, however I will be happy
to give you recommendations or have the painting framed in a style you choose.
Oil Painting Fees
My goal when painting is to create an image that is as close to life as possible.
Often I will go beyond what is really there and create my own enhanced version
of reality-this may be in the form of an unusual weather pattern or exaggerated
lighting. The idea is to captivate the viewer and bring that person in to the
world I have created. That is what drives me to paint each piece to the best of
my ability.
Only the finest materials available in the world are used to ensure that your
painting will last-'Old Holland' lightfast paints and Belgian Linen are a combination
that has been proven to endure for hundreds of years.
I have been asked to paint many subjects and each I have found creates it's own
challenge. It is hard to set fee guidelines for work I have yet to envision but
these are the general categories. Please inquire for a more precise estimate.
Small Oil Painting From 14 x 22 to 16 x 26...............................................$14,000-18,000
Medium Oil Painting From 18 x 24 to 22 x 34...........................................$20,000-24,000
Larger Oil Painting From 24 x 36 to 30 x 48..............................................$26,000-30,000
Special Renditions....................................................................................$30,000
and up
